This photograph print, titled "Port at Douarnenez" by Dutch artist Gerrit van Blaaderen, dates back to the 1920s. The image transports us to the picturesque fishing port of Douarnenez, located in Finistere, Brittany, France. The scene is set against a serene green-blue background of the tranquil water, with a group of fishermen dressed in red, adding a pop of vibrant color to the image. The fisherfolk are shown in various stages of arrival and departure, some tending to their nets while others are preparing to set sail. The use of chalk on paper and watercolor paint gives the image a soft, impressionistic feel, capturing the essence of the local industry and the daily life of the working class fishermen in this coastal community. The orange color of the deck paint on the boats adds a warm contrast to the cool tones of the water and sky, making for a visually striking composition. This evocative image offers a glimpse into the past, showcasing the rich cultural heritage of the fishing industry in Europe during the 1920s.
